Archive | Video Games RSS feed for this section

Freedom Fighters

As the uprisings in the Arab world intensify, we’ve heard a lot about the influence of the internet, Google, Twitter, Facebook, etc. But, what about war games? Tweet Share

Read full story Comments { 891 }